Why are our backs to the Camera?

It's a Physical Metaphor

Our decision to present ourselves with our backs to the camera is more than a mere style choice; it's a powerful testament to our fundamental principles and security strategy. The phrase "Quiet Professionals," commonly attributed to elite Tier One forces, encapsulates a philosophy of humility, discretion, and impactful action sans the pursuit of public acclaim. This commitment is meaningful in numerous respects:

  • Prioritizing Work Over Fame: In an era dominated by a self-centric culture, where social media often encourages a relentless pursuit of personal exposure and fame, Trusted Tribe deliberately chooses a different path. Our backs to the camera are a statement against this mentality. It's a visual representation that the work we do takes precedence over personal recognition. We are focused on the greater good, the vital work of cybersecurity, and the safety of those we protect. It's a commitment to the collective effort and success of the Tribe.
  • Anonymity as a Strategic Advantage: Safeguarding personal identities is paramount to successful security focused work. Presenting ourselves with our backs to the camera symbolizes our dedication to privacy and operational security (OpSec), and underscores the importance of protecting not just ourselves but our families, friends, fellow Tribe members, and the entire community we serve.
  • Building Trust and Relationships: We work closely with other organizations, governments, and communities around the world to help make the digital (and physical) world safer for everyone (except the bad guys). Our approachable and low-key demeanor helps in building trust and fostering effective partnerships, which are crucial for mission success.
  • Symbolizing Unity and Solidarity: Our unified posture reflects the solidarity among our team members. It visually conveys that we are a cohesive unit, each member equally important, all working in unison towards our shared objectives.
  • Focusing on the Future: Turning away from the camera also signifies our forward-looking perspective. It's about always moving forward, relentlessly pursuing innovation and progress in the cybersecurity landscape. Those who are locked in the past or are unable to respond to the shifting dynamics that is at the very core of risk mitigation and security, are always behind the power curve.
  • Promoting Inclusivity: Our people are everything. Without exception. By not focusing on individual faces though, we invite you to see us as a united and cohesive group. We're the kind of people that believe in removing names from sports jerseys. It's about the team, not the individual players. From the CEO to the analyst, we are all equally important and form an important part of our Tribe. This approach also greatly minimizes biases related to physical appearance, race, gender, and other personal attributes.
  • Embracing the Role of Protectors: Like sentinels vigilant against threats, our posture suggests a protective stance over our clients and community. It's a visual metaphor for our role as guardians in the digital world.
  • Humility and Discretion: We all strive to operate at the high level of skill and competence while maintaining humility and discretion. We often undertake critical missions that require secrecy and a low profile for operational success and personal safety. Our work is frequently conducted behind the scenes, and we are known for our ability to blend in, rather than stand out. Arrogance and hubris not only hinders personal and professional development, but it's often seen as deeply disrespectful, particularly in cultures that value collective success over individual prominence. Prioritizing the team over self-aggrandizement is essential for fostering success.
  • Creating Mystery and Engagement: Our unique presentation also adds an element of mystery and intrigue. You probably can't name another company that presents itself like this on their corporate website. And if you can, it's not many. This kind of thing piques curiosity about who we are and what we do, serving as an engaging way to draw interest in our work and mission. Let's be honest, you're already wondering what many of us look like, who we are, where we come from, and what our backgrounds are.

Synergism Matters:

Our approach to team building and our strategic goals is further illustrated by the concept of 'synergy' which is rooted in the idea that the combined effect of a group of people, entities, elements, or systems working together is greater than the sum of their individual effects. This principle, often summarized by the phrase "the whole is greater than the sum of its parts," highlights how collaboration and cooperation can produce outcomes that are impossible to achieve independently. In includes these key elements:

  • Collaborative Efficiency: Synergy occurs when collaboration leads to a more efficient or effective outcome. For example, a team working together might complete a project more quickly or effectively than the same individuals working separately.
  • Enhanced Creativity and Innovation: In a synergistic environment, the diverse perspectives and skills of different individuals can spark more creative and innovative ideas. This is often seen in brainstorming sessions where the collective input leads to solutions that wouldn't have been discovered by any single person.
  • Compounding Strengths: Synergy leverages the strengths of each participant. In a team, each member may bring unique skills or knowledge that, when combined, create a more capable and robust entity.
  • Mitigating Weaknesses: Similarly, the weaknesses of one member can be offset by the strengths of others. In a synergistic relationship, vulnerabilities are minimized because they are covered by the collective strengths.
  • Shared Goals: Synergy often arises when individuals or groups align on a common goal or purpose. This alignment ensures that efforts are complementary and directed towards a unified objective.
  • Positive Interdependence: This is the recognition that success for one contributes to success for all. In a synergistic group, members are interdependent in a way that their actions positively affect the whole.
  • Amplified Learning: In a synergistic setting, knowledge sharing is amplified. Participants not only learn from their own experiences but also gain insights from the experiences and knowledge of others.
  • Resilience: Synergistic systems or teams can be more resilient to challenges and changes. The diverse skills and perspectives can contribute to finding innovative solutions during difficult times.

Synergy is a powerful concept in various contexts, from business and science to social movements and community building. It underscores the value of collaboration, diversity, and shared purpose in achieving exceptional results. This is why it undergirds everything we do.
